Prospective Pilot Clinical Trial of Azithromycin Treatment In RSV-induced Respiratory Failure In Children
In Brief
A Phase 2 clinical trial evaluating Azithromycin 10 mg, Azithromycin 20mg, and 1 other intervention for Respiratory Syncytial Virus. Completed, enrolled 48 participants across 1 site.
Detailed Summary
This randomized, double-blind, placebo-controlled phase 2 trial will be conducted at a single tertiary pediatric intensive care unit (PICU). The study will include children with RSV infection who were admitted to the pediatric intensive care unit and require respiratory support via positive pressure ventilation (invasive and noninvasive).
